| +// Both sync and password db have data that are not present in the other. |
| +TEST_F(PasswordSyncableServiceTest, AdditionsInBoth) { |
| + autofill::PasswordForm* form1 = new autofill::PasswordForm; |
| + form1->signon_realm = "abc"; |
| + std::vector<autofill::PasswordForm*> forms; |
| + forms.push_back(form1); |
| + SetPasswordStoreData(forms); |
| + |
| + SyncData sync_data = CreateSyncData("def"); |
| + SyncDataList list; |
| + list.push_back(sync_data); |
| + |
| + verifier()->SetExpectedDBChanges(list, |
| + std::vector<autofill::PasswordForm*>(), |
| + password_store_); |
| + verifier()->SetExpectedSyncChanges( |
| + SyncChangeList(1, CreateSyncChange(*form1, SyncChange::ACTION_ADD)), |
| + sync_change_processor_.get()); |
| + EXPECT_CALL(*service_, NotifyPasswordStoreOfLoginChanges()); |
| + |
| + service_->MergeDataAndStartSyncing(syncer::PASSWORDS, |
| + list, |
| + ReleaseSyncChangeProcessor(), |
| + scoped_ptr<syncer::SyncErrorFactory>()); |
| +} |
| + |
| +// Sync has data that is not present in the password db. |
| +TEST_F(PasswordSyncableServiceTest, AdditionOnlyInSync) { |
| + SetPasswordStoreData(std::vector<autofill::PasswordForm*>()); |
| + |
| + SyncData sync_data = CreateSyncData("def"); |
| + SyncDataList list; |
| + list.push_back(sync_data); |
| + |
| + verifier()->SetExpectedDBChanges(list, |
| + std::vector<autofill::PasswordForm*>(), |
| + password_store_); |
| + verifier()->SetExpectedSyncChanges(SyncChangeList(), |
| + sync_change_processor_.get()); |
| + EXPECT_CALL(*service_, NotifyPasswordStoreOfLoginChanges()); |
| + |
| + service_->MergeDataAndStartSyncing(syncer::PASSWORDS, |
| + list, |
| + ReleaseSyncChangeProcessor(), |
| + scoped_ptr<syncer::SyncErrorFactory>()); |
| +} |
| + |
| +// Passwords db has data that is not present in sync. |
| +TEST_F(PasswordSyncableServiceTest, AdditionOnlyInPasswordStore) { |
| + autofill::PasswordForm* form1 = new autofill::PasswordForm; |
| + form1->signon_realm = "abc"; |
| + std::vector<autofill::PasswordForm*> forms; |
| + forms.push_back(form1); |
| + SetPasswordStoreData(forms); |
| + |
| + verifier()->SetExpectedDBChanges(SyncDataList(), |
| + std::vector<autofill::PasswordForm*>(), |
| + password_store_); |
| + verifier()->SetExpectedSyncChanges( |
| + SyncChangeList(1, CreateSyncChange(*form1, SyncChange::ACTION_ADD)), |
| + sync_change_processor_.get()); |
| + |
| + service_->MergeDataAndStartSyncing(syncer::PASSWORDS, |
| + SyncDataList(), |
| + ReleaseSyncChangeProcessor(), |
| + scoped_ptr<syncer::SyncErrorFactory>()); |
| +} |
| + |
| +// Both passwords db and sync contain the same data. |
| +TEST_F(PasswordSyncableServiceTest, BothInSync) { |
| + autofill::PasswordForm *form1 = new autofill::PasswordForm; |
| + form1->signon_realm = "abc"; |
| + std::vector<autofill::PasswordForm*> forms; |
| + forms.push_back(form1); |
| + SetPasswordStoreData(forms); |
| + |
| + verifier()->SetExpectedDBChanges(SyncDataList(), |
| + std::vector<autofill::PasswordForm*>(), |
| + password_store_); |
| + verifier()->SetExpectedSyncChanges(SyncChangeList(), |
| + sync_change_processor_.get()); |
| + |
| + service_->MergeDataAndStartSyncing(syncer::PASSWORDS, |
| + SyncDataList(1, CreateSyncData("abc")), |
| + ReleaseSyncChangeProcessor(), |
| + scoped_ptr<syncer::SyncErrorFactory>()); |
| +} |
| + |
| +// Both passwords db and sync have the same data but they need to be merged |
| +// as some fields of the data differ. |
| +TEST_F(PasswordSyncableServiceTest, Merge) { |
| + autofill::PasswordForm *form1 = new autofill::PasswordForm; |
| + form1->signon_realm = "abc"; |
| + form1->action = GURL("http://pie.com"); |
| + form1->date_created = base::Time::Now(); |
| + std::vector<autofill::PasswordForm*> forms; |
| + forms.push_back(form1); |
| + SetPasswordStoreData(forms); |
| + |
| + verifier()->SetExpectedDBChanges(SyncDataList(), |
| + forms, |
| + password_store_); |
| + verifier()->SetExpectedSyncChanges( |
| + SyncChangeList(1, CreateSyncChange(*form1, SyncChange::ACTION_UPDATE)), |
| + sync_change_processor_.get()); |
| + |
| + EXPECT_CALL(*service_, NotifyPasswordStoreOfLoginChanges()); |
| + |
| + service_->MergeDataAndStartSyncing(syncer::PASSWORDS, |
| + SyncDataList(1, CreateSyncData("abc")), |
| + ReleaseSyncChangeProcessor(), |
| + scoped_ptr<syncer::SyncErrorFactory>()); |
| +} |
